Alice, I understand your cynicism, but have you thought about the flip side of the equation - that without overseas collectors, many of these guys would have a much smaller market? In that respect, is the 80/20 ratio a drain or a lifeline? And, how many of these guys would have blown up to this extent, providing seed money and the ability to produce many new toys, were it not for regular cash infusions from overseas orders? Just wondering.
Finally, and this is pure curiosity, in your dealings with sofubi makers (and speaking fluent Japanese as you do), have you detected bitterness among the sofubi makers because of the 80/20 split and reliance on overseas markets? Is there a general sense (aside from personal observations such as the popularity of clear and orange vinyl) among sofubi makers that creative decisions are being made to pander to non-Japanese collectors?

@ Prometheum: I mean Orange. It used to be Super7's flagship color, though I think that phase may have passed now. @ Andy: Don't take the piss - your Japanese is probably way better than mine & you know it! And you're right, of course there's a flipside: Wherever the resurgence of interest in sofubi has come from it's been a godsend to the likes of Gargamel, Marmit and M1go and inspired a lot of new makers to come forward as well. It's just that as a lover of the 'oldskool kaiju' I look at a lot of these new figures and find myself wondering: "Who is the target market here?" Is there any bitterness among the sofubi makers? Well, I think Kozik's comments about the Bemon guy were probably a distortion rather than a fabrication. I don't believe he was too happy in the beginning when all his figures started going abroad, and for such shockingly high prices as well. However, given all of the above, I think they're coming round, don't you? @ Everybody: I want to stress again that all the above thoughts are JUST MY OPINION and nothing to do directly with either Nag Nag Nag or Bouryoku Genjin, about whom there will be an announcement next Monday or Tuesday. Yeah my sense is the new sofubi makers are happy that at least somebody wants their stuff. I agree, if it weren't for manic foreigners bidding stuff up on YJA, hot-footing it to Tokyo, and importing figures for resale in other countries, most of these guys would still be hobbyists attending shows 3-4 times a year, or shop owners specializing in old school sofubi and selling their own figures on the side (which some still do). But I also get the sense the sofubi makers would be happier if more Japanese collectors were into their figures. It's not by accident that Nakano Broadway and the various Mandarakes are the best places to get new sofubi - it's because those are the places most frequented by foreign collectors.  About old/new skool sofubi, I think, at least in some sub-segments, there's a meshing going on as the cross-pollenation of Western and Eastern monster styles continues. Guys like Paul Kaiju, Nagata, and Lamour are making their mark in Japan. To me, the intercultural monster mash is one of the most interesting outcomes of all this.
